A straight line makes an angle of 135∘ with x–axis and cuts y-axis at a distance of – 5 from the origin. The equation of the line is.
A
2x+y+5=0
B
x+2y+3=0
C
x+y+5=0
D
x+y+3=0
Answer
x+y+5=0
Explanation
Solution
Let the equation of line is y=mx+c
Given line makes an angle of 135∘ with x-axis
So, m=tanθ=tan135∘=−1and cuts the intercepts – 5
from origin to y-axis i.e., c=−5
Hence, equation of line is y=−x−5⇒x+y+5=0.
